London

My family and I just went to London and we had the very best time! A few honorable mentions of fun things we did are visit Windsor Castle, explored the Cotswolds, took a stroll through Notting Hill, spent an afternoon in Hyde Park, visit Kensington Palace and had afternoon tea at Sketch. There are seriously so many different things to do there, and each is better than the next, but my biggest recommendation is to soak it all in and do as much as you can. It’s not super often we get to go abroad and when we do, we like to make the most of it!

Boston

Boston is super close to NYC and it’s a great option for a city to bring kids to. A few things we love to do when we visit are stroll through Boston Common, visit the Boston Harbor, check out the Brattle Bookshop, spend the day at the New England Aquarium, Shop on Newbury Street and find great food spots to check out. Big cities are full of great food and honestly, just exploring is fun in itself.

Paris

Paris is always a good idea! We haven’t been there in a few years, but I am always longing to go back. A few things we think are worth checking out are the Musee de Louvre, obviously the Eiffel Tower, the Luxembourg Gardens and Versailles Palace. Turks and Caicos

This place is true paradise. The water is crystal clear, they have great spas and incredible water activities. If you’re active, you should check out boat tours, go kayaking, deep sea diving, snorkeling, parasailing and so much more! My family and I love to come here and relax. It’s so nice to even just sit on a pretty beach and enjoy the moment and make memories with my family. Sometimes just stopping all the busy activities and taking time to unwind is enough of a vacation. We do love to stay active, though!

The Bahamas

How could you not love the beach?! What we love about The Bahamas is that there is so much to do and it’s pretty much all family friendly! You can go snorkeling, deep diving, a national park or simply relax on a private island. The hotels are packed with events, happenings and of course, spas! Baha Mar has some great activities like swim in a pool area that has a window for you to watch all the sea creatures! Swimming with dolphins is up there for best things to do, though.

Key West

Key West is a great part of Florida to take a spring break. There are so many things to do whether you are taking spring break from college or bringing your family. You can take a private charter, take a bike tour along the beach, see Dry Tortugas National Park, swim with dolphins or just relax on the beach!

Portugal

Portugal is an absolutely stunning place to visit. The culture is simply amazing and don’t even get me started on the food! Delicious! You can try canoeing at Furnas Lake, lay out at Matosinhos Beach, visit Oceanario de Lisboa or explore Castelo de Guimaraes. That castle is truly a wonder!

 

Cabo

If you haven’t been to Cabo, let me tell you this is a top spring break destination that I recommend! There are some great resorts there and so many cool activities that aren’t common. Make sure to check out the camel safari, sunset cruises, snorkeling, whale watching and ziplining! Any time there is ziplining, my kids are happy! It’s also a great place to get some great sun.

Hilton Head Island

Hilton Head is an underrated place to visit! It’s a great little town with fun local happenings. The beaches are perfect for tubing, kayaking and swimming with dolphins. There are spots to play tennis, great pools, go on bike rides and of course, shop at the cute stores there! It’s very family friendly, as well! I recommend airbnbing.

 

California

There are so many places to check out in California for spring break, but I would definitely recommend San Francisco and Lake Tahoe. San Francisco is a great big city to explore, you have to see the full house home and the golden gate bridge. So much good food, as well! Lake Tahoe is great for outdoor adventures. There are gondola rides, white water rafting, hiking and of course, more water activities to enjoy with friends and family.

Austin, Texas

Austin Texas is weird in the best way possible! There are fantastic restaurants with some of the best food and drinks in the country, obviously get some barbecue! You can go on the Butler Bike and Hike Trail, check out Barton Springs Pool, go to music festivals, see one of their many great museums and see the Bee Cave. This city has endless activities and is great for both families and friends!

 

Yosemite

This is another perfect outdoor adventure for spring break. Definitely bring your kids here if you haven’t been yet because it’s a great place to mark off your places to visit list! You can go hiking, take wilderness tours, go camping, paint pictures of nature in a peaceful environment and so much more!

 

Spain

Spain is another beautiful place to go! The food is absolutely outstanding and if nothing else, that and the culture are the most important reasons to go! A few notable things to do are see Granada, Valencia, Barcelona and The Canary Islands. There are plenty of parks and areas to check out, as well as beaches to relax on.

 

Naples

Naples is an underrated place to visit for spring break! The atmosphere there is just so different from NYC, but in such a good way. It’s calm, quiet and warm. There’s cute places to shop and eat and you can get an airbnb on the beach to make it even nicer! Waking up and being able to walk to the beach is just a great feeling on vacation. Some cool things to do are to see the Corkscrew Swamp Sanctuary, go to the Naples Pier and the botanical gardens.

Portland

Portland is another city you need to cross of your list! It’s just so artsy and cool there, how could you not want to see it for yourself? You need to fully immerse yourself in what the locals are doing. Go to the Saturday Markets, Powell City of Books, The International Rose Test Garden, eat at Voodoo Doughnut and finish at the Portland Art Museum. I’d say this is the best place for friends, more than to bring kids to, but it is definitely family friendly, just a little chilly there sometimes!
